| The SPA3102 features the ability to connect standard telephones and fax
machines to IP-based data networks with the additional benefit of an
integrated connection for legacy telephone network "hop-on, hop-off"
applications. SPA3102 users will be able to leverage their broadband
phone service more than ever by automatically routing local calls from
mobile phones and land lines over to VoIP service providers and vice
versa. If power is lost to the unit or Internet service is down, calls
can be redirected to a traditional carrier via the FXO interface.
A user calling from a mobile phone or land line will be able to reduce
and even eliminate international and long distance telephone charges by
first calling their SPA3102 via a local telephone number. The advanced
authentication and call routing intelligence programmed into the
SPA3102 will route the call via the Internet to the far end
destination. In addition, when using the SPA3102 at the far end, VoIP
calls placed to that location can be either answered or further
processed and routed on as a local call to any legacy land line or
mobile phone.
The SPA3102 supports one RJ-11 POTS (Plain Old Telephone Service) FXS
port to connect an existing analog phone or fax machine. The SPA3102
also supports one PSTN FXO port to connect to a Telco or PBX circuit.
The SPA3102 includes 2 100BaseT RJ-45 Ethernet interfaces to connect to
a home or office LAN, as well as an Ethernet connection to a broadband
modem or router. The SPA3102 FXS and FXO lines can be independently
configured via software controlled by the service provider or the end
user.
Installed by the end user and remotely provisioned, configured and
maintained by the service provider, each SPA3102 converts voice traffic
into data packets for transmission over an IP network. Compact in
design, the SPA3102 can be used in consumer and business VoIP service
offerings including a full-featured IP Centrex environment. The SPA3102
uses international standards for voice and data networking for reliable
voice and fax operation.
Highlights
Toll Quality Voice and Carrier-Grade Feature Support
The SPA3102 delivers clear, high-quality voice communication in diverse
network conditions. Excellent voice quality in a demanding IP network
is consistently achieved via our advanced implementation of standard
voice coding algorithms. The SPA3102 is interoperable with common
telephony equipment like voicemail, Fax, PBX, and interactive voice
response systems.
Large-Scale Deployment and Management
The SPA3102 offers all the key features and capabilities which service
providers can provide customized VoIP services to their subscribers.
The SPA3102 can be remotely provisioned and supports dynamic,
in-service software upgrades. A secure profile upload saves providers
the time, expense, and hassle of managing and pre-configuring or
re-configuring customer premise equipment (CPE) for deployment.
